Acts from across Ireland & the UK are set to light up the Grand Social this Spring.
The full line up for the Reverberation Psych Fest has been announced.
The festival is taking place at The Grand Social, Dublin, on April 8 & 9 2016.
Organisers have gathered a broad-ranging mix of Psych-based musicians from home and abroad.
The Reverberation weekend will feature The Cosmic Dead (UK), The Cult Of Dom Keller (UK), The Black Tambourines (UK), Twinkranes, Wild Rocket, Woven Skull, Fabric (NI), I ♡ The Monster Hero, Sun Mahshene.
Tickets will be on sale from Monday February 15th 2016 fromwww.tickets.ie.

Read a full description of all the acts below.
The Cosmic Dead (UK): For anyone who hasn’t yet stood before the Dead and their live homage to the cosmos, expect religious devotion to synthesized dreamworlds, subsonic grooves, guitaristic splendour and the vast, hypnotic sounds of Hawkwind and Popol Vuh eternally jamming in the Möbius strip of time and space.
The Cult Of Dom Keller (UK): Since 2008 this psych vessel from Nottingham redefines the parameters of psych music, spiking the fuzz laden nuggets with shoegaze and noise. Their music can be as dreamy as Spacemen 3, as harsh as Jesus & Mary Chain or as dangerous as Brian Jonestown Massacre.
The Black Tambourines (UK): Falmouth's Black Tambourines put in the best performance I saw at this year's Great Escape (nme) Blissfully hazy garage flower-punk in the same vain as The Black Lips, the material is born from long days spent dreaming by the coast in their native Cornwall.
Twinkranes: Dublin’s Twinkranes create psychedelic progressive pop skillfully harassing drone and the motorik beats of Krautrock to create a hypnotic & visceral live show and a brief but noticeable rip in the space-time continuum.
Woven Skull: Woven Skull create a contrast of minimal drones, repetition and psychedelic distorted riffs all layered in constant unconscious rhythms.
Beach: Beach are a 5 piece band based in Dublin. Beach have developed a unique blend of psychedelia infused with elements of electronica and slacker rock whilst expanding their live show by incorporating visuals to create a more immersive expression of their music.

Wild Rocket: WILD ROCKET plays space metal. WILD ROCKET plays heavy psychedelic. WILD ROCKET endures. WILD ROCKET lives.
Fabric (NI): Started in Summer of 2014, continuously writing and perfecting original material and live sets, striving to invent a new sound by exploring many different genres/artists and musical styles.
I Heart The Monster Hero: The music they make has been described as 'fuzzed-up swirl of pop-laminated psych punk.
Sun Mahshene: Sun Mahshene is a collective of musicians from Dublin, Ireland. Their melodic hooks mixed with fuzz and grit delivers a sonic wall of sound.
